1. FTP服務(wù)器的基本概念
FTP服務(wù)器是一種運行在計算機上的應(yīng)用程序,它可以提供文件傳輸服務(wù)。通過FTP服務(wù)器,用戶可以在不同的計算機之間進行文件的上傳和下載,實現(xiàn)遠程文件訪問和共享。FTP服務(wù)器以客戶端/服務(wù)器的方式工作,客戶端通過FTP客戶端軟件與服務(wù)器建立連接,進行文件的傳輸操作。
2. FTP服務(wù)器的工作原理
FTP服務(wù)器遵循客戶端/服務(wù)器模型,它使用一種特定的文件傳輸協(xié)議(FTP協(xié)議)來實現(xiàn)文件的傳輸和管理。當客戶端與服務(wù)器建立連接后,客戶端可以通過不同的FTP命令向服務(wù)器發(fā)送請求,服務(wù)器則根據(jù)客戶端的請求執(zhí)行相應(yīng)的操作,并將結(jié)果返回給客戶端。FTP服務(wù)器可以通過不同的配置和權(quán)限管理實現(xiàn)對文件的訪問控制和安全性的保護。
3. FTP服務(wù)器的重要功能
FTP服務(wù)器提供了一系列的功能和特性,以滿足不同用戶的需求。以下是一些常見的FTP服務(wù)器功能:
文件傳輸: 用戶可以通過FTP服務(wù)器進行文件的上傳和下載,實現(xiàn)不同計算機之間的文件共享和交換。
目錄管理: FTP服務(wù)器允許用戶對文件和目錄進行管理,例如創(chuàng)建、刪除、重命名和復(fù)制等操作。
權(quán)限控制: FTP服務(wù)器可以設(shè)置用戶的訪問權(quán)限,控制用戶對文件和目錄的讀寫權(quán)限,以及訪問的限制。
匿名訪問: FTP服務(wù)器支持匿名訪問,允許未經(jīng)授權(quán)的用戶使用特定的用戶名和密碼登錄服務(wù)器,并獲取部分文件或目錄的訪問權(quán)限。
日志記錄: FTP服務(wù)器可以記錄用戶的登錄和文件傳輸操作,以便管理員進行審計和監(jiān)控。
4. FTP服務(wù)器的應(yīng)用領(lǐng)域
FTP服務(wù)器廣泛應(yīng)用于各個領(lǐng)域,滿足了不同組織和個人的文件共享需求。以下是一些常見的應(yīng)用領(lǐng)域:
企業(yè)內(nèi)部: 組織內(nèi)部的文件共享、部署軟件和更新補丁等。
網(wǎng)站運維: 網(wǎng)站的文件上傳和下載、網(wǎng)頁內(nèi)容更新和維護。
多媒體傳輸: 音頻、視頻等多媒體文件的傳輸和共享。
遠程辦公: 在不同地點的團隊成員之間進行文件協(xié)作和共享。
個人用戶: 個人文件備份、跨設(shè)備的文件同步和共享。
5. FTP服務(wù)器的安全性考慮
雖然FTP服務(wù)器提供了便捷的文件共享方式,但在實際應(yīng)用中需要注意安全性問題:
用戶名和密碼的安全性: 用戶在登錄FTP服務(wù)器時,需要使用用戶名和密碼進行身份驗證。因此,用戶名和密碼的安全性至關(guān)重要,應(yīng)該避免使用弱密碼、定期更換密碼,并采用加密方式傳輸。
防火墻和網(wǎng)絡(luò)安全: FTP服務(wù)器通常運行在計算機內(nèi)網(wǎng)中,需要在防火墻中配置相應(yīng)的規(guī)則,以限制FTP服務(wù)的訪問和傳輸,保護服務(wù)器的安全。
文件加密和傳輸安全: 對于敏感數(shù)據(jù)和文件,可以考慮使用加密算法對文件進行加密,并通過SSL/TLS等安全協(xié)議來保護數(shù)據(jù)傳輸?shù)陌踩?/p>
6. FTP服務(wù)器的常見軟件和工具
市場上存在許多成熟的FTP服務(wù)器軟件和工具,適用于不同的操作系統(tǒng)和應(yīng)用場景。以下是一些常見的FTP服務(wù)器軟件:
FileZilla Server: 開源的FTP服務(wù)器軟件,支持Windows操作系統(tǒng)。
VSFTPD: 輕量級的FTP服務(wù)器軟件,適用于Linux操作系統(tǒng)。
Cerberus FTP Server: 商業(yè)化的FTP服務(wù)器軟件,擁有豐富的功能和易用的管理界面。
7. 總結(jié)
FTP服務(wù)器作為一種重要的文件傳輸工具,為用戶提供了便捷、安全和高效的文件共享方式。通過了解FTP服務(wù)器的概念、工作原理和功能,我們能夠更好地應(yīng)用該技術(shù),并滿足各種文件共享需求。為了保障文件傳輸?shù)陌踩裕覀冃枰⒁饷艽a的安全性、網(wǎng)絡(luò)安全和加密傳輸?shù)确矫娴膯栴}。選擇適合的FTP服務(wù)器軟件和工具,也是實現(xiàn)便捷文件共享的重要一環(huán)。